Esophagogastric Junction pressure morphology: comparison between a station pull-through and real-time 3D-HRM representation
BACKGROUND: Esophagogastric junction (EGJ) competence is the fundamental defense against reflux making it of great clinical significance. However, characterizing EGJ competence with conventional manometric methodologies has been confounded by its anatomic and physiological complexity. Recent technol...
